The benefits of Family Camp

In addition to our long tradition of residential camping, we are also proud of over thirty years of Summer Family Camp at YMCA Wanakita.

This past summer, one of our Family Campers shared a thoughtful and touching letter with our Director.

"Thank you for a most wonderful week at Family Camp- truly the best one we have had in 4 years. Before camp, we were talking about directing our resources elsewhere for family vacations and making this our last year. By the second day of camp, Ken and I had both (independently) decided to review this choice! We will definitely be back - hopefully for many more years. We had forgotten the magic of camp. We particularly enjoyed watching our girls try out new skills - archery, kayaking, and swims to the island! We saw them grow in confidence and become more of their true selves.

The week gave us, as adults, a break from the mundane things that so often consume our thoughts (what's for dinner, do we need to pack lunches for tomorrow, when was the last time the laundry got done...) and reminded us of who we were and what was important to us before life became more complicated! It was so reassuring to discover this part of us still exists and we are thinking of ways to bring our true selves back into our lives now even though we have lots of responsibilities.

With gratitude for the week and the life lessons beyond..."

Thanks to all who made Summer 2011 such a wonderful success, and we look forward to making more memories in 2012!

Facing your fears at camp

Winter has been busy here at Wanakita! Since late December, our Outdoor Centre has welcomed a number of schools, teams, and special interest groups. We love being able to share our winter wonderland with children, yotuh,and adults from across the province.

One memorable even occurred a few weeks ago, when we welcomed a group of grade 11 students from an inner city Toronto school. This group spent one afternoon tobogganing, and the majority of the students had never experienced sliding down a hill before. Our staff were amazed to see that the seemingly toughest student in the group was noticeably afraid to go sliding. He hesitated at the top of the hill, and then screamed the whole way down. Despite his initial fear, he loved the ride and immediately ran up to the top of the hill to go sliding again! This young man learned to face his fears, overcome an unfamiliar situation, and experienced success because of it.

We at Wanakita are fortunate to be a part of these incredible outcomes of play every day.
